《電子技術應用》
您所在的位置:首頁 > 嵌入式技術 > 設計應用 > TMS320C30系統與PC104進行雙向并行通信的方法
TMS320C30系統與PC104進行雙向并行通信的方法
鄭繼剛
摘要: 給出一種TMS320C30/PLD系統與PC104通過標準并行接口進行雙向通信時擴展并口的方法,給出了硬件實現電路的框圖,分析了通信過程中握手信號的時序關系,并列出了通信測試程序的流程圖。
Abstract:
Key words :

    摘  要: 給出一種TMS320C30/PLD系統與PC104通過標準并行接口進行雙向通信時擴展并口的方法,給出了硬件實現電路的框圖,分析了通信過程中握手信號的時序關系,并列出了通信測試程序的流程圖。

  關鍵詞: 數字信號處理(DSP)  可編程邏輯器件(PLD)  VHDL  并行通信

 

    TMS320C30是TI公司的通用DSP芯片,它有很強的浮點/定點數據運算能力和很高的處理速度,特別適合于進行實時的數據采集及運算處理(如FFT,FIR、IIR濾波等)。但是,DSP一般I/O能力及文檔處理能力較弱,所以,常常將DSP系統與PC104組成主機/從機系統,由PC104擔負系統的各模塊(分機)的管理、I/O設備的通信、文檔處理等任務;而由DSP實現數據采集和實時處理。

  因為C30沒有標準通信接口,需要進行擴展。與PC機的通信可以通過標準異步串口進行,也可以通過標準并口進行,串口的特點是抗干擾能力強、連接較簡單、編程也較方便,因而應用較廣泛;但在對實時性要求較高的場合,其通信速度往往不能滿足要求,這時可以通過標準并口進行。標準并口的擴展可以采用通用并行接口芯片,如8255、TL16C552等。但是,由于現在的數字電路系統一般都包含PLD,可以利用PLD的資源進行并行口的擴展,這樣做有很多優點:利用現有資源,節省器件成本;節省電路板尺寸;功能的修改或擴展較容易,便于與以后新的接口標準兼容;由于可以根據實際需要對通用接口芯片的功能進行簡化,軟、硬件的設計都更加方便。

1 PC104的并口結構

  PC104的并行接口可以工作在PC/AT方式,在這種方式下,接口只能輸出數據,主要用于控制打印機等輸出設備。也可以工作在PS/2方式,在這種方式下,它可以雙向傳輸數據,我們就采用這種方式進行PC104與DSP的通信,C30的并口也采用與PC104兼容的結構和編程方式。

  標準并口的信號定義如表1所示。

 

  其中包含八位雙向數據線(PD0~PD7),四根控制線(輸出)和五根狀態線(輸入)。

  標準雙向并口的控制寄存器如表2所示。

 

  寄存器位的定義與相應信號線的定義相同。但是,信號BSY、AFDn、STBn與寄存器中的定義是互為反向關系的,在編程時要注意。DIR控制數據的流向,為0時輸出,為1時輸入。PRINTn是打印機中斷狀態位,沒有使用;INT2EN是中斷允許控制位,可以不用,對這兩個寄存器位不做更多說明。

2  并口擴展的方法

2.1 硬件結構

  我們采用四線握手制進行通信,其連接如圖1所示。

 

  根據這種要求我們可以設計出所需要的并行接口,如圖2所示。與標準并口相比,它只工作在雙向方式;狀態線、控制線都少一些(但是可以根據實際情況擴充);與CPU的接口采用了較為簡化的設計,信號定義如下:XD[7..0]為C30的擴展數據總線的低八位,XA[1..0]為擴展地址總線的低二位,CS為片選信號,XR/Wn為擴展總線的讀寫控制信號,IOSTRBn為擴展總線的選通脈沖,INT為并口的中斷信號輸出,采用ACKn的下降沿觸發C30中斷,與標準并口不同(上升沿);寄存器的地址偏移量采用與標準并口相同的方式,基地址則可以由系統的設計決定。

  并行接口的設計采用VHDL語言來描述,以適用于不同的PLD器件。

2.2 時序分析

  下面我們描述通信過程的時序關系。通信程序在發送時采用查詢方式,而接收時則采用中斷方式。因為PC104與C30執行程序的速度不同,處理中斷的方式也不同,因而PC104發往C30與C30發往PC104時的握手信號的時序也有一些區別,圖3、圖4分別是兩種情況下的時序圖。圖中,只標出了時序的先后關系,具體的數值要遵守并口的標準并在程序調試中確定。

 

 

  因為PC104的STBn的后沿(上升沿)是個斜坡(10μs左右)發送完一個字節后,要延時一段時間,待STBn穩定后,才能發送下一個字節;否則,C30的中斷不能可靠觸發,將造成通信的錯誤。發送速率為每字節15μs左右。

這種情況下限制發送速度的因素主要是PC104響應和處理通信中斷的時間,對C語言編寫的接收程序進行優化也可以使通信速度控制在15μs左右。

2.3 軟件流程圖

  下面我們舉一個例子來說明PC104與C30進行通信的過程。在這個調試程序中,PC104先發送一組數據,C30接受完后再返回一組數據給PC104,然后通信結束。圖5、6、7、8描述的分別是PC104上的主程序、接收中斷服務子程序、C30上的主程序以及接收中斷服務子程序的流程圖。

 

 

參考文獻

1 (美國)Texas Instruments公司.TL16C552 Data Book

2 盛博公司PC104技術手冊

3 (美國)Texas Instruments公司.TMS320C3X用戶指南

4 李繼燦,李華貴編著.新編16-32位微型計算機原理及應用.北京:清華大學出版社

此內容為AET網站原創,未經授權禁止轉載。
热re99久久精品国产66热_欧美小视频在线观看_日韩成人激情影院_庆余年2免费日韩剧观看大牛_91久久久久久国产精品_国产原创欧美精品_美女999久久久精品视频_欧美大成色www永久网站婷_国产色婷婷国产综合在线理论片a_国产精品电影在线观看_日韩精品视频在线观看网址_97在线观看免费_性欧美亚洲xxxx乳在线观看_久久精品美女视频网站_777国产偷窥盗摄精品视频_在线日韩第一页
  • <strike id="ygamy"></strike>
  • 
    
      • <del id="ygamy"></del>
        <tfoot id="ygamy"></tfoot>
          <strike id="ygamy"></strike>
          夜夜夜精品看看| 激情成人在线视频| 亚洲高清在线播放| 亚洲国产高清一区二区三区| 一本色道久久综合| 国产精品免费网站| 麻豆久久婷婷| 在线日韩av永久免费观看| 在线免费不卡视频| 国产欧美在线播放| 国产精品免费观看在线| 久久精品视频免费| 国内精品免费午夜毛片| 国产精品一区二区a| 午夜精品三级视频福利| 亚洲精品美女在线观看| 久久视频国产精品免费视频在线| 欧美va亚洲va日韩∨a综合色| 欧美精品国产精品日韩精品| 国产欧美日韩亚洲| 亚洲综合日韩| 欧美中日韩免费视频| 在线一区亚洲| 欧美小视频在线| 久久久久久久一区二区三区| 欧美韩日一区| 久久国产乱子精品免费女| 国产欧美1区2区3区| 午夜久久福利| 欧美在线视频免费观看| 狠狠爱www人成狠狠爱综合网| 黄色成人在线网址| 亚洲一区三区在线观看| 久久精品国产99精品国产亚洲性色| 日韩一级在线| 欧美视频三区在线播放| 精品99一区二区| 裸体素人女欧美日韩| 国产精品成人免费视频| 亚洲综合色丁香婷婷六月图片| 国产精品裸体一区二区三区| 国产一区二区日韩精品欧美精品| 国产综合久久久久影院| 欧美在线欧美在线| 欧美国产第一页| 欧美理论片在线观看| 亚洲日本成人网| 狠狠做深爱婷婷久久综合一区| 欧美激情五月| 性做久久久久久免费观看欧美| 欧美xxxx在线观看| 伊人蜜桃色噜噜激情综合| 久久福利一区| 欧美在线欧美在线| 久久精品国产久精国产一老狼| 久久久久综合网| 亚洲一区二区三区影院| 亚洲欧美激情在线视频| 另类欧美日韩国产在线| 亚洲免费大片| 欧美中文字幕在线播放| 免费中文日韩| 小嫩嫩精品导航| 久久在线视频在线| 亚洲国产精品毛片| 欧美日本高清一区| 国产原创一区二区| 国精产品99永久一区一区| 国产欧美婷婷中文| 一区二区三区成人精品| 亚洲在线免费观看| 久久精品成人一区二区三区| 国产女主播在线一区二区| 在线观看视频欧美| 亚洲国产成人精品久久久国产成人一区| 久久中文欧美| 欧美不卡一区| 在线观看日韩专区| 亚洲一区在线播放| 亚洲欧美在线播放| 六月丁香综合| 国产欧美日韩亚洲一区二区三区| 在线观看欧美日韩| 亚洲香蕉视频| 影音先锋欧美精品| 久久综合久久美利坚合众国| 欧美在线999| 亚洲丝袜av一区| 激情欧美亚洲| 欧美激情国产日韩精品一区18| 韩国在线视频一区| 欧美成人自拍| 久久亚洲精品一区二区| 亚洲一区二区三区午夜| 狠狠狠色丁香婷婷综合激情| 亚洲精选91| 国产主播一区二区三区四区| 免费观看日韩| 国产伊人精品| 老司机精品导航| 中文国产亚洲喷潮| 午夜亚洲福利在线老司机| 久久久青草婷婷精品综合日韩| 国产精品入口日韩视频大尺度| 欧美在线一二三四区| 亚洲国产婷婷香蕉久久久久久99| 欧美日韩三级| 国内精品嫩模av私拍在线观看| 欧美精品videossex性护士| 久久精品国产亚洲精品| 亚洲综合视频网| 久久亚洲捆绑美女| 国产精品亚洲一区二区三区在线| 免费观看日韩| 亚洲激情小视频| 男人天堂欧美日韩| 99热精品在线| 欧美高清视频在线| 欧美一区二区在线看| 欧美日韩免费精品| 欧美在线地址| 欧美激情一级片一区二区| 亚洲精品激情| 一色屋精品视频在线观看网站| 欧美日韩午夜精品| 欧美日韩欧美一区二区| 国产精品一级久久久| 伊人狠狠色丁香综合尤物| 久久综合九色| 欧美成人一区二区三区| 日韩视频免费在线观看| 欧美性色aⅴ视频一区日韩精品| 久久成人免费| 欧美阿v一级看视频| 欧美午夜视频网站| av成人黄色| 最新中文字幕一区二区三区| 亚洲午夜免费福利视频| 久久一日本道色综合久久| av成人毛片| 欧美日韩在线观看一区二区| 国产精品久久久久久久电影| 久久亚洲国产成人| 在线视频日韩| 欧美a级片网站| 国产精品国产三级国产普通话99| 亚洲激情在线播放| 国产精品国码视频| 国产精品久久毛片a| 午夜日韩福利| 欧美午夜一区二区三区免费大片| 亚洲网址在线| 久久国产免费看| 国产精品亚洲а∨天堂免在线| 国产精品久久久久一区二区三区共| 亚洲精品一区二区网址| 在线观看日韩一区| 韩国欧美一区| 欧美成年人在线观看| 欧美a级一区二区| 99国内精品久久久久久久软件| 久久精品噜噜噜成人av农村| 久久久久久有精品国产| 曰本成人黄色| 免费不卡亚洲欧美| 国产资源精品在线观看| 亚洲第一精品久久忘忧草社区| 欧美日韩p片| 欧美无乱码久久久免费午夜一区| 国产女人18毛片水18精品| 中文日韩在线| 国产精品福利片| 亚洲伦理在线| 欧美a级片网| 性欧美在线看片a免费观看| 女人色偷偷aa久久天堂| 国产欧美日韩专区发布| 国产一区二区三区在线免费观看| 久久亚洲春色中文字幕久久久| 一本久道久久综合狠狠爱| 韩日精品在线| 久久亚洲综合| 国产精品成人久久久久| 免费视频一区二区三区在线观看| 国产精品视频免费观看www| 亚洲一区视频在线| 亚洲欧美在线另类| 日韩一区二区电影网| 欧美1区视频| 久久女同精品一区二区| 亚洲激情图片小说视频| 亚洲国产精品久久| 欧美成人网在线| 最新日韩在线| 亚洲美女在线视频| 国产精品网站一区| 日韩亚洲综合在线| 亚洲欧美日韩爽爽影院| 亚洲午夜免费福利视频| 亚洲第一黄色网| 亚洲一区成人| 国产亚洲精品久久久久久| 欧美日韩亚洲激情| 久久久久国产一区二区三区四区| 亚洲一区二区不卡免费| 欧美人成在线视频| 国产亚洲网站| 国产精品美女视频网站| 欧美日韩在线精品| 最新高清无码专区| 久久青草久久| 国产精品主播| 99精品免费| 亚洲欧洲精品一区二区| 欧美天堂在线观看| 久久久国产精品一区| 欧美成人乱码一区二区三区| 国产午夜精品麻豆| 欧美77777| 久久激情五月激情| 久久精品中文| 精品99一区二区| 99re成人精品视频| 亚洲欧美精品中文字幕在线| 久久夜色精品国产欧美乱极品| 欧美成人免费在线| 久久久青草婷婷精品综合日韩| 亚洲另类自拍| 欧美偷拍另类| 亚洲精品久久久久久一区二区| 欧美三级视频在线播放| 国产精品视频99| 99xxxx成人网| 亚洲视频一区在线| 久久电影一区| 国产一区 二区 三区一级| 久久久www成人免费毛片麻豆| 欧美电影免费网站| 乱码第一页成人| 国产精品视频第一区| 欧美国产视频在线观看| 国产精品一区二区在线观看不卡| 欧美日韩免费在线观看| 欧美激情中文字幕在线| 欧美成人午夜| 狠狠爱综合网| 久久精品亚洲国产奇米99| 欧美成人午夜激情在线| 久久免费偷拍视频| 日韩视频国产视频| 亚洲麻豆视频| 西西人体一区二区| 亚洲黑丝在线| 激情六月婷婷综合| 欧美日韩精品免费观看视频| 欧美aⅴ一区二区三区视频| 巨胸喷奶水www久久久免费动漫| 男女视频一区二区| 亚洲欧美激情四射在线日| 欧美日韩中文字幕精品| 国产精品夜夜嗨| 欧美精品麻豆| 欧美成人综合一区| 久久综合给合久久狠狠色| 一本久道久久综合狠狠爱| 国产精品美女久久久久aⅴ国产馆| 亚洲精品免费在线观看| 午夜精品久久99蜜桃的功能介绍| 欧美一区二区三区久久精品茉莉花| 蜜桃精品久久久久久久免费影院| 国产精品乱码人人做人人爱| 在线观看一区二区视频| 欧美高清在线一区| 国产麻豆午夜三级精品| 亚洲欧美一区二区视频| 亚洲国内高清视频| 欧美亚洲一区三区| 欧美一区二视频在线免费观看| 国产乱码精品一区二区三| 国产精品视频内| 欧美激情精品久久久久久免费印度| 国产日韩欧美综合精品| 亚洲一区在线观看视频| 欧美日韩另类综合| 亚洲一区二区在线| 欧美日韩理论| 艳女tv在线观看国产一区| 亚洲午夜一区二区三区| 韩国福利一区| 正在播放亚洲一区| 国产精品一区二区你懂得| 亚洲激情影院| 亚洲福利电影| 久久精品国产亚洲精品| 国产精品你懂的在线| 久久精品国产成人| 午夜精品久久久久久久99水蜜桃| 欧美一区二区福利在线| 激情综合中文娱乐网| 欧美日本中文字幕| 国产日韩欧美一区二区| 亚洲激情网址| 久久精品国内一区二区三区| 亚洲无玛一区| 久久动漫亚洲| 欧美日韩免费一区二区三区视频| 亚洲在线免费视频| 亚洲与欧洲av电影| 日韩网站在线| 一区二区精品在线观看| 亚洲在线不卡| 亚洲国产日韩欧美| 国产欧美一区二区精品秋霞影院| 欧美在线播放视频| 亚洲福利专区| 蜜臀久久99精品久久久久久9| 欧美日韩免费一区二区三区视频| 国产伦精品一区二区| 国产日韩成人精品| 激情亚洲一区二区三区四区| 欧美精品一区二区三区高清aⅴ| 最新国产成人在线观看| 国产精品av一区二区| 一区二区视频欧美| 欧美日韩综合在线免费观看| 欧美日产国产成人免费图片| 欧美激情综合亚洲一二区| 尤物九九久久国产精品的特点|